01. CHICKEN TRACTOR ART CENTER INSTRUCTOR : Brad Hartman & Jessica Terrill STUDIO : ARCH 401 | Fall 2015 TEAM : Lidwina Natasha Gunawan & Tripti Upreti LOCATION : Des Moines, IA

Chicken tractors are mobile chicken coops that urban farmers use to let their chickens range safely. Even the most difficult land will become verdant if the chickens are allowed to be chickens on it. Put your coop down on a terrible spot of your yard and a few months later your land will be fertile and rich. We are treating this art center just like a chicken tractor, by selecting the most underdevelop neighbourhood and letting the artists to work their magic to develop the neighborhood.

03. LA MADERA INSTRUCTOR : Tom Leslie & Lee Cagley STUDIO : Panama Studio | Fall 2016 TEAM : Lidwina Natasha Gunawan, Mackenzie Barton, Nate Thiese LOCATION : Panama City, Panama

As part of the redevelopment of former military sites at the east (Pacific) entrance to the Panama Canal, a developer has secured rights to a large parcel along the shoreline roughly halfway between the Puente de las Americas—the main vehicle crossing over the Canal—and the new Biomuseo (Frank Gehry and Partners, 2014). The area around the site is seeing rapid redevelopment, with a new convention center and a growing nightlife district, and the developer is seeking to appeal to both tourists and convention attendees with a hotel that includes business and meeting facilities as well as a spa complex. In keeping with regional development, the local government requires that the development achieves substantial sustainability and biodiversity goals, in addition to being a landmark for the city and nation at one of the most visible points along the Canal. To further enhance the effort of developing the Amador LA MADERA is a one stop destination for visitors who want to relax by enjoying the nature of Panama City while still being connected to business/work events. Nature is being expressed in the interior spaces of LA MADERA through Ipe wood columns and structures, which is a very sustainable choice for the environment of Panama City. Large and small events are also being accomodated comfortabaly inside the hotel. Public spaces which are located on the first and second floor of LA MADERA react to the surrounding site, while the tower relates more to the larger context of Panama City.

02. TANADEWA VILLA AND RESORT PRINCIPAL : Jan Steven Tjandra & Lisa Teo STUDIO : Atelier TT | Summer 2015 TEAM : Talissa Danubrata, Lidwina Natasha Gunawan, & Era Premakara LOCATION : Tanadewa, Bali, Indonesia

Tanadewa Villa and Resort is a design proposal for the land owner. Involving an intense topography and also design constraints, this project pushed the team to maximize the landuse. Atelier TT also focused on bringing a modern touch to this Bali traditional style resort. We wanted to create an ultimate experience for the guests by creating a few anchor points (pool, yoga terrace, spa, etc) and multipurpose space for the guests to use for special events and occasions, like wedding. We also created efficient program space and system for Back of House activities to even further enhance the ultimate experience for the guests.

04. AIRFIELD THEATER INSTRUCTOR : Firat Erdim STUDIO : DSN S 546 | Spring 2017

This project is an investigation of kites as instruments of empathy with the atmosphere. A kite could be thought of as a dress – an adornment of the sky; or as an analogue of the body - with bones, skin, and muscles/tendons; as an analogue to architecture; as a sacrificial assemblage of materials given (up) to the wind, for it to inhabit and animate, as would a spirit; or, as happens with a pencil or tennis racket, a means of extending of one’s consciousness beyond the limits of one’s own skin, out into the atmosphere. To further investigate the relationship between kites and one’s body, I explored the action and reaction effect between the two. Traditionally, the kite is the dominant component; it controls one’s body movement as it flies and stabilizes. In this particular design, I wanted to changes relationship; having one’s body as the steer and alpha between the two. Thus, in this non-traditional arrangement, a twist on the connection points between kite and body is crucial.

05. BENEATH THE GOLD PROJECT : Non Architecture Competition - Showing LOCATION : Grasberg Mine, Papua, Indonesia

What lies underneath the gold mine? The Grasberg mine in Papua has become one of the largest gold mine in the world ever since it was opened in 1973. However, with the gold being all depleted what does being the largest gold mine entail now? Beneath all the gold that was taken from the land reveals a deeper consequence of this thoughtless act done by humanity. This project focuses on showing how much destruction a single gold mine can do towards its surrounding environments and inhabitants. As people walk through the museum, they will encounter numbers that go from 1 till 45 to mark the number of years of the mine operation. In addition to these marking on the floor, the west wall will show the number of gold that was harvested and its value while the east show will how much damage this mine has done to its surroundings. The long path leads to a dramatic ending that will remind each visitor how a small act can have larger consequences.
